Welcome to my Friends for Life Bike Rally page.
I would like to tell you about my reasons for riding . I became a participant in the bike rally to honour the memory of my friends Mark, Bill ,Kent and Grant . They were good people who welcomed me into their lives . We drank , we danced , we had fun . And then they died .
Mark was the first person I knew who became HIV positive. He told me and we both cried .He was living with his partner and some room mates at the time . He used to come to my apartment to rest . He went home to North Bay where he died . I was a pallbearer at Marks funeral . It was the first funeral I attended . We made no mention of AIDS . He died of cancer said his family .
Kent called me one night and told me he was taking pills to kill himself. I called 911 and they took him yo the hospital . I saw him at his house a few days later and he pointed at his skeletal self and joked that I had saved him for this . He went home to his family and died .
Bill was in the hospital . He had said that he didn't want extraordinary measures taken when his time was near . He changed his mind . He didn't want to die . He died . His sister invited us over to his place after he died and said we could have something to remember him by . I chose a plant which I managed to keep alive for a pretty long time. It moved with me to a few apartments. Then it died .
Grant and I were really good friends . He showed me the ways of gay life in Toronto .We had so much fun . We were close for a very long time . Then like friendships sometimes do we drifted apart . He used to call me after he'd had a few drinks and I was sometimes not as gracious as I could have been . He used to call late in the evening and I had to work the next day .We kept on saying we would get together and hang out but we didn't . The Thursday before a long weekend he called and left a message . I never returned the call . He died that weekend . I still feel guilty that I never returned the call . At his funeral there was also no mention of AIDS . He too died of a cancer he didn't have .
I made a commitment to raise funds for PWA because of my friends who died terrible deaths . And because I am fortunate enough to be healthy enough to do so . Even though I am getting old !
The funds that I help raise help people living with HIV and AIDS live better lives . It helps feed , medicate , and support them in many ways .
I ride to erase the stigma for people living with HIV and AIDS . And more selfishly I do it because it helped me get over the loss of my friends. And because it is fun ! And I have made many friends over the years I have participated . They are the nicest people in the world . Except of course my family , friends and colleagues :-)
